Transaction 3859f310031943c395f162a5fc91a56a4ae4ee61ca36e0770a07ce36eea74b6c
1 Input
1 Output
-
3859f310031943c395f162a5fc91a56a4ae4ee61ca36e0770a07ce36eea74b6c:0
- value
- 444703
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3b025998d1792eb03214573242c8f70f353514f
- address
- bc1qcwcztxvdz7fwkqepg4ejgty0wre4x520wzknp2